In the wake of attacks on oil tankers in the Gulf of Oman, for which the U.S. blames Iran, Acting Defense Secretary Patrick Shanahan says the U.S. is always "planning for various contingencies," but adds that "we need to develop international consensus...we also need to broaden our support." The secretary also says that he is working to be more transparent in releasing information about the attacks on the oil tankers and the origins of the mines that were used in the attacks. close
